About Austin Sunshine Camps (ASC):
The mission of ASC is to provide the magic of overnight camp without the barrier of cost. We envision a world where all children have a place to grow, connect, and explore. Since 1928, ASC has provided FREE, fun-filled overnight summer camp programs for children by partnering with families who face barriers to accessing such programs.
ASC offers overnight camp programs during the summer, spring break, and winter break. Our overnight camps are accredited by the American Camp Association (ACA), which represents the industry’s highest standard. Each year, we provide overnight camp to 760 children ages 8 to 15. Our 8 to 11-year-olds attend our Zilker Camp in Zilker Park and our 12 to 15-year-olds attend our Lake Travis Camp in Marble Falls. They swim, canoe, hike, learn new skills, create crafts, make music, and much more.
The Summer Rhythm
- The Commitment: Camp runs for four sessions, each lasting 10 days and 9 nights. This is an immersive, overnight experience where you’ll be the heart of your cabin's world. Note that staff members live on site.
- Rest & Recharge: We value your well-being. After each 10-day session, you’ll participate in a team cleanup and debrief before enjoying 4 full days off to explore Austin or relax before the next session starts.
- Pro-Tip for Students: You can use your summer at ASC for college internship credit while still receiving your seasonal pay.
Our Locations
- Lake Travis (Ages 12-15): A classic hill country setup in the Turkey Bend Recreation Area. Think lake swimming, high ropes courses, and sunset sports.
- Zilker Lodge (Ages 8-11): Located in the heart of central Austin. You’ll spend your days canoeing Lady Bird Lake, hiking the Greenbelt, and exploring Zilker Park.
